Are the running game problems primarily related to the offensive line execution, James Conner, or coaching strategy? It sounds like Tomlin thinks it’s the former, but I see a lot of designed runs to run at or outside the tackle by a back (Conner) who’s pretty slow comparatively and dances a lot without hitting any holes quickly. Why not try Snell and McFarland more if they want to start the run parallel to the line and just design north-south runs for Conner?
Ray Fittipaldo
2:25
It's a combination of all those things you mentioned. I'm looking forward to seeing the changes this week, but this Jaguars secondary is bad, and the Steelers should take advantage of it.

Hey Ray, I’m an eternal optimist, but let’s be real. Some at the PG have mentioned this line is BUILT TO PROTECT BEN, so they’re not going to match up well against a good run-stopping D-line. That’s also why Ben rarely gets sacked. I get worn down suggesting we have to run better. Why take something that’s an embedded weakness and try to turn it around mid-season? Why not keep playing to our strengths, win games, and be good with that? This line does get great matchups sometimes in the run game, and when that happens, coaches take advantage. When they don’t, Ben takes over and we usually win.
Ray Fittipaldo
2:43
Because at some point you're going to need to get a yard like the Baltimore game, like the Dallas game. They've been fortunate to win some of these games without a good running game. I like that Tomlin is acknowledging the problem and attempting to fix it. I'm not convinced he can, but I think he's right to have a sense of urgency about it.
